It's one of the UK Vodafone deals, so comes with xp rather than the ubuntu option. Short Version Tried to boot from the cute lil' preformatted pd usb stick but no joy - hangs. Made own usb installer via the info on the debian page http://www.debian.org/releases/stable/i386/ch04s04.html.en and here http://d-i.pascal.at/#obtain again http://www.unicom.com/blog/entry/563 Maybe I'm missing something 'cos I'm doing this via iceweasel but finding those files 'vmlinuz' etc was a drag, I couldn't figure how to find them through the debian site but finally stumbled on the ftp site via google http://ftp.debian.org/debian/dists/testing/main/installer-i386/current/image s/hd-media/ Whilst trying to install with Debian's 'advance graphical installer, via usb, everytime it got to 'searching network devices', would be told that it couldn't find one. Interestingly when I tried auto adv install it worked? Problem with that is, it installed the full system; on an 8G drive that's a pain. Then added the new and super-shiny wget http://debian.goto10.org/debian/pool/main/p/puredyne-settings/puredyne-setti ngs_20081120_i386.deb dpkg -i puredyne-settings_20081120_i386.deb nice When booting with '7-rt21' kernel (same point with live install stick) it hangs here Udevd-event[745]: run_program: '/sbin/modprobe' abnormal exit I also tried '1-rt15' This gets as far as 'debian login', then the 'Failed to start the X server' window On the plus side Got Bluetooth and wiimotes running with pure data (cheers mike woz) http://mikewoz.com/index.php?page=pd-stuff http://www.wiili.org/index.php/CWiid Oh joy. Camera works. Nothing working yet with the vodaphone 3g/gpsd card.
